How To Fix CRM_IC_WZ_CUST_ENH015 - The relationship name is not valid


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: CRM_IC_WZ_CUST_ENH - Wizards for Customer Enhancements in IC WebClient

  • Message number: 015

  • Message text: The relationship name is not valid

    The SAP error message CRM_IC_WZ_CUST_ENH015 indicates that there is an issue with the relationship name being used in the context of the SAP CRM Interaction Center (IC). This error typically arises when the system cannot recognize or validate the relationship name specified in a transaction or configuration.

    Cause:

    1. Invalid Relationship Name: The relationship name you are trying to use may not exist in the system or may have been incorrectly entered.
    2. Configuration Issues: The relationship type may not be properly configured in the system, or it may not be assigned to the relevant business object.
    3.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to access or use the specified relationship.
    4. Data Consistency: There may be inconsistencies in the data, such as missing entries in the relevant tables.

    Solution:

    1. Check Relationship Name: Verify that the relationship name you are using is correct. You can do this by checking the configuration in the SAP system.

      • Navigate to the relevant customizing transaction (e.g., SPRO) and check the settings for relationships under CRM.
    2. Review Configuration: Ensure that the relationship type is properly configured and assigned to the relevant business objects. You may need to consult with your SAP administrator or functional consultant to review the configuration settings.

    3. Authorization Check: Ensure that the user has the necessary authorizations to access the relationship. You can check the user roles and authorizations in transaction SU01.

    4. Data Consistency Check: Run consistency checks on the relevant data to ensure that there are no missing or inconsistent entries. This may involve checking the relevant tables in the database.

    5.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or notes related to CRM and the specific error message for additional guidance and troubleshooting steps.

    6. Contact SAP Support: If the issue persists after checking the above points, consider reaching out to SAP support for further assistance. Provide them with details of the error, including the context in which it occurs.
